Interview: Lambo TheGod

1. What is your name and where are you from?


Michael Unamba from Glenn Dale, Maryland


2. What inspired you to make music? Who are some artists that you believe have

influenced your sound?


Myself & my friend Ahmad. In 2017, I wanted to get his music a bigger platform so I agreed to

be his manager. Looking for ideas for exposure, I decided to do a song with him. I got good

feedback and people told me to continue.


3. If there is anyone you could collaborate with, who would it be?


Drake, Future, 10kdunkin, Playboi carti, Tems, Snoh Aalegra, Lil Uzi, Lil Yachty,

& Chief Keef


4. What would you define your genre of music as?


I make rap music, I’ve been experimenting with sounds like for example my newest album is

gonna be all R&B sounds & instrumentals with a mix of rapping, singing & melodic rap


5. What do you believe is limiting you?


The only thing limiting me is myself. I don’t beat myself about it because the greater I strive to be, the better outcome it’ll have on my music, life & career


6. What are your long term goals as a person and as an artist?


Financial stability & freedom. I want to perform at a festival and get more into acting &

modeling. Money isn’t really a goal with my music, I just want people to respect my craft &

share the energy that I’m creating with me.


7. When could fans see you perform?


Whenever my next show is! I was a special guest for two shows in College Park but i do need to book my shows for myself to spread out.


8. What do you believe is your best work?


Too hard to say. As an artist, every other thing we create we believe is our best.

My most cohesive songs I’ll say are: One of a kind, Derek Fisher, Still Drippin, Bought

Everything & my newest song off my album Having my way featuring TinaJay.
